rs179008 (A/T) and rs3853839 (C/G) polymorphisms are associated with variations in IFN-α levels in HTLV-1 infection.

Abstract

INTRODUCTION

TLR7 detects the presence of single-stranded RNA (ssRNA) viruses, including human T-lymphotropic virus 1 (HTLV-1), and triggers antiviral and inflammatory responses that are responsible for infection control. Genetic variations in the gene may alter cytokine production and influence the course of HTLV-1 infection. In the present study, the associations of gene polymorphisms with HTLV-1-related symptoms, receptor expression levels, IFN-α and TNF-α levels and the proviral load were investigated.

METHODS

Blood samples from 159 individuals with HTLV-1 infection (66 with inflammatory diseases and 93 asymptomatic individuals) and 159 controls were collected. The genotyping of polymorphisms, TLR7 gene expression analysis and the quantification of the proviral load were performed by real-time PCR, and cytokine measurement was performed by enzyme-linked immunosorbent assay (ELISA).

RESULTS

Carriers of the polymorphic allele for rs179008 (A/T) had lower levels of IFN-α, while carriers of the polymorphic allele for rs3853839 (C/G) had higher levels of TLR7 and IFN-α expression. The polymorphisms were not associated with symptoms of diseases related to HTLV-1 infection. The combination of A/G alleles for the rs179008 (A/T) and rs3853839 (C/G) polymorphisms was associated with increased IFN-α levels and a decreased proviral load.

DISCUSSION

Although the polymorphisms did not influence the presence of symptoms of diseases caused by HTLV-1, carriers of the wild-type alleles for rs179008 (A/T) and the polymorphism for rs3853839 (C/G) appears to have a stronger antiviral response and increased infection control.

摘要

引言

Toll样受体7(TLR7)可检测单链RNA(ssRNA)病毒的存在,包括人类嗜T淋巴细胞病毒1型(HTLV-1),并触发抗病毒和炎症反应,这些反应负责控制感染。该基因的遗传变异可能会改变细胞因子的产生,并影响HTLV-1感染的进程。在本研究中,研究了TLR7基因多态性与HTLV-1相关症状、受体表达水平、干扰素-α(IFN-α)和肿瘤坏死因子-α(TNF-α)水平以及前病毒载量之间的关联。

方法

收集了159例HTLV-1感染个体(66例患有炎症性疾病,93例无症状个体)和159例对照的血样。通过实时聚合酶链反应(PCR)进行多态性基因分型、TLR7基因表达分析和前病毒载量定量,通过酶联免疫吸附测定(ELISA)进行细胞因子检测。

结果

rs179008(A/T)多态性等位基因携带者的IFN-α水平较低,而rs3853839(C/G)多态性等位基因携带者的TLR7和IFN-α表达水平较高。这些多态性与HTLV-1感染相关疾病的症状无关。rs179008(A/T)和rs3853839(C/G)多态性的A/G等位基因组合与IFN-α水平升高和前病毒载量降低有关。

讨论

尽管这些多态性不影响HTLV-1所致疾病症状的出现,但rs179008(A/T)野生型等位基因携带者和rs3853839(C/G)多态性者似乎具有更强的抗病毒反应和更好的感染控制能力。
